I consider good relations with neighboring countries and regional cooperation to be a top priority in Lithuania's foreign policy.
The Baltic and Nordic countries are united by common interests. Their successful cooperation is best reflected in the EU Strategy for the Baltic Sea Region. It is the first macro-regional strategy which I believe will accelerate regional development and help resolve issues of concern for the whole region. Therefore, the implementation of this strategy is and will continue to be of utmost importance to the Baltic Sea countries in the next several years. The Baltic Sea states are bound together by common economic, infrastructural, cultural, and scientific interests as well as by joint strategic projects. I am quite sure that projects are implemented better and more successfully through a network of permanent and trustworthy partners.
Such networks are created by youth and other non-governmental organizations. People who grow up in these organizations use their contacts for building the region's common future. It is not by chance that the non-governmental sector - the civil-minded people, the academic community and, of course, youth -is seen in Lithuania, like in other Baltic Sea region countries, as an active player for implementation the Baltic Sea Strategy.
